Cách tăng tốc trang web WordPress của bạn bằng cách trì hoãn thực thi JavaScript

Nkenganyi Clovis Hướng dẫn WordPress Dec 14, 2023

Bạn có bao giờ cảm thấy trang web WordPress của mình chạy chậm hơn một con ốc sên trên máy chạy bộ không? Bạn biết đấy, loại thất vọng khiến bạn muốn ném máy tính xách tay của mình ra ngoài cửa sổ và hét lên tận cùng phổi? Vâng, tất cả chúng tôi đã ở đó.

Có thể bạn đã thử mọi cách để tăng tốc trang web của mình, từ bộ nhớ đệm, thu gọn đến tải từng phần. Nhưng dường như không có gì tạo nên sự khác biệt đáng kể. Bạn vẫn bị mắc kẹt với một trang web chậm chạp, tải liên tục và gây khó chịu cho khách truy cập.

Điều gì sẽ xảy ra nếu chúng tôi nói với bạn rằng có một cách đơn giản để tối ưu hóa hiệu suất trang web WordPress của bạn bằng cách sử dụng Trì hoãn thực thi JavaScript ? Một cách có thể giảm thời gian tải ban đầu, cải thiện điểm số Core Web Vitals của bạn và tránh một số lỗi và xung đột. Nghe có vẻ quá tốt để có thể là sự thật phải không?

Vâng, không phải vậy. Đó là một tính năng được tích hợp trong một trong những plugin lưu vào bộ nhớ đệm tốt nhất trên thị trường: WP Rocket .

Tạo trang web tuyệt vời

Với trình tạo trang miễn phí tốt nhất Elementor

Bắt đầu bây giờ

Trong bài đăng trên blog này, chúng tôi sẽ chỉ cho bạn cách sử dụng nó để tăng tốc độ và hiệu suất trang web của bạn. Sẵn sàng để bắt đầu? Đi nào!

Tên lửa WP là gì?

WP Rocket là một plugin bộ nhớ đệm cao cấp giúp cải thiện tốc độ và hiệu suất của trang web WordPress của bạn. Thay vì các tập lệnh PHP cồng kềnh, nó thực hiện điều này bằng cách tạo các tệp HTML tĩnh từ các trang WordPress động của bạn và phân phối chúng cho khách truy cập của bạn. Điều này làm giảm gánh nặng cho máy chủ của bạn và cải thiện thời gian phản hồi của trang web của bạn.

WP Rocket còn cung cấp nhiều tính năng khác để tối ưu hóa trang web của bạn, chẳng hạn như:

  • Nén GZIP: giảm kích thước tệp và tiết kiệm băng thông.
  • Bộ nhớ đệm trình duyệt: lưu trữ tài nguyên tĩnh trong trình duyệt, giảm số lượng truy vấn đến máy chủ của bạn.
  • Giảm thiểu và ghép nối: giảm số lượng yêu cầu HTTP bằng cách xóa các khoảng trắng và nhận xét không cần thiết khỏi mã của bạn, đồng thời kết hợp nhiều tệp thành một.
  • LazyLoad: Trì hoãn việc tải hình ảnh và iframe cho đến khi chúng xuất hiện trên màn hình, tiết kiệm băng thông và cải thiện thời gian tải.
  • Tích hợp CDN: phân phối tài liệu của bạn trên mạng lưới máy chủ toàn cầu để cung cấp tài liệu đó cho khách truy cập nhanh hơn.
  • Tối ưu hóa cơ sở dữ liệu: xóa dữ liệu không cần thiết khỏi cơ sở dữ liệu của bạn và giảm kích thước của nó.
  • Tải trước: tạo trước bộ nhớ đệm cho trang chủ của bạn và tất cả các trang được liên kết để cải thiện khả năng lập chỉ mục của các công cụ tìm kiếm.
  • Và hơn thế nữa...

WP Rocket có thể giúp bạn trì hoãn việc thực thi JavaScript như thế nào?

WP Rocket bao gồm khả năng trì hoãn việc thực thi JavaScript. Tính năng này tăng hiệu suất bằng cách trì hoãn việc tải tất cả các tệp JavaScript và tập lệnh nội tuyến cho đến khi xảy ra tương tác với người dùng (ví dụ: di chuyển chuột qua trang, chạm vào màn hình, cuộn, nhấn phím, cuộn bằng con lăn chuột). Nó hoạt động tương tự như LazyLoad nhưng dành cho các tệp JavaScript.

Việc trì hoãn thực thi JavaScript có thể nâng cao số liệu hiệu suất trang web của bạn như Thời gian hiển thị nội dung đầu tiên (FCP), Thời gian hiển thị nội dung lớn nhất (LCP) và Thời gian tương tác (TTI) bằng cách giảm thời gian tải ban đầu của các trang web của bạn. Các số liệu này rất có ý nghĩa đối với trải nghiệm người dùng và SEO vì Google xếp hạng chúng trong Core Web Vitals.

WP Rocket nhận ra các tập lệnh có thể bị trì hoãn một cách an toàn và áp dụng độ trễ cho chúng. Trong cài đặt WP Rocket, bạn cũng có thể chỉ định thủ công các từ khóa xác định tệp cần trì hoãn.

Làm cách nào tôi có thể kích hoạt độ trễ thực thi JavaScript trong WP Rocket?

Để kích hoạt tính năng thực thi JavaScript bị trì hoãn trong WP Rocket, hãy thực hiện các bước sau:

Bước 1: Cài đặt và kích hoạt WP Rocket trên trang WordPress của bạn.

Để làm điều đó, bạn có thể truy cập trang web WP Rocket , đăng nhập và mua plugin để có tất cả các tính năng mà bạn có thể sử dụng trong các phần trình diễn mà chúng tôi sẽ giới thiệu cho bạn bên dưới.

Sau khi mua plugin và tải xuống tệp zip, hãy đi tới Plugin > Thêm mới trên bảng điều khiển WordPress của bạn và nhấp vào Tải plugin lên ở đầu trang.

Sau khi nhấp vào Tải plugin lên , một cửa sổ mới sẽ xuất hiện, tại đây bạn sẽ thấy hộp "Chọn tệp". Bạn sẽ phải nhấp vào nó và chọn tệp trình cài đặt zip trong phần quản lý tệp của mình.

Khi bạn chọn file zip, hãy nhấp vào nút Install Now .

Đi tới Cài đặt > WP Rocket > tab Quy tắc nâng cao .

Cuộn xuống phần Trì hoãn thực thi JavaScript .

Thêm từ khóa trong các trường Tập lệnh cần Trì hoãn hoặc Tập lệnh để loại trừ khỏi các trường Trì hoãn , được phân tách bằng dấu phẩy.

Lưu các thay đổi được thực hiện.

Ví dụ: nếu bạn muốn trì hoãn tất cả các tập lệnh có từ "jquery" hoặc "analytics" trong tên của chúng, hãy nhập các thuật ngữ này vào phần Tập lệnh cần trì hoãn.

Nếu bạn muốn bỏ qua tất cả các tập lệnh có cụm từ "WooCommerce" hoặc "cart" trong tên của chúng, hãy nhập chúng vào Tập lệnh cần bỏ qua khỏi khu vực Trì hoãn.

Lợi ích của việc trì hoãn thực thi JavaScript là gì?

Bằng cách trì hoãn việc thực thi JavaScript, bạn có thể tận hưởng một số lợi ích cho trang web WordPress của mình, chẳng hạn như:

  • Thời gian tải nhanh hơn: Bạn có thể giảm lượng thời gian cần thiết để các trang web của mình tải và hiển thị nội dung bằng cách trì hoãn việc thực thi JavaScript. Điều này có thể tăng trải nghiệm người dùng, khả năng giữ chân và xếp hạng SEO.
  • Số liệu hiệu suất được cải thiện: Bằng cách trì hoãn thực thi JavaScript, bạn có thể tăng số liệu hiệu suất của trang web của mình như FCP, LCP và TTI. Các phép đo này theo dõi xem trang web của bạn có thể sử dụng được và tương tác với người dùng nhanh như thế nào. Google cũng sử dụng chúng làm yếu tố xếp hạng trong Core Web Vitals.
  • Ít lỗi và xung đột hơn: Bằng cách trì hoãn thực thi JavaScript, bạn có thể ngăn chặn một số lỗi và xung đột có thể xảy ra khi tải và thực thi nhiều tập lệnh cùng lúc. Ví dụ: một số tập lệnh có thể dựa vào các tập lệnh chưa được tải hoặc có thể tương tác với nhau. Trì hoãn thực thi JavaScript có thể giúp tránh những vấn đề này và mang lại trải nghiệm người dùng tốt hơn.

Phần kết luận

Cuối cùng, trì hoãn việc tải và thực thi mã JavaScript không cần thiết cho đến khi người dùng tương tác với trang hoặc cuộn xuống là một chiến lược tuyệt vời để tăng hiệu suất trang web WordPress.

WP Rocket là một plugin mạnh mẽ có thể cho phép người dùng thực hiện dễ dàng và thành công việc thực thi JavaScript bị trì hoãn trên các trang web WordPress của họ, cũng như các tính năng khác có thể cải thiện tốc độ và hiệu quả của trang web.

Người dùng có thể tăng thời gian tải trang web, điểm Tốc độ trang, trải nghiệm người dùng và chuyển đổi bằng cách sử dụng chức năng Thực thi JavaScript trễ của WP Rocket.

Divi WordPress Theme